Allen-Bradley 1756-L73S GuardLogix Integrated Safety System Controller

The Allen-Bradley 1756-L73S GuardLogix Processor is a high-performance control module designed for advanced automation systems, providing exceptional processing power and safety integration capabilities.

Description

Model Type:Processor

Manufacturer:Allen-Bradley

Processor Model Number:1756-L73S

Additional Information:GuardLogix® Integrated Safety System Controller

Memory:8 MB

Safety Memory:4 MB

I/O Memory:0.98 MB

Optional Non-Volatile Memory Storage:[“1 GB”,”2 GB”]

Mounting:Chassis

Isolation:30 V (Continuous), Basic Insulation

USB Port:To Backplane

Type Tested At:500 VAC For 60 SEC

Enclosure:Open Type

Rfi Suppression:[“Radiated: 10 V/M With 1 KHZ Sine-Wave 80% AM From 80 – 2000 MHZ”,”10 V/M With 200 Hz 50% Pulse 100% AM At 900 MHZ”,”10 V/M With 200 Hz 50% Pulse 100% AM”]
